A/C compressor replacement cost?
On our '03 H2 the A/C went out the other day, and when I took it to service today, they say the compressor is in need of replacement....the quote to have it fixed is $1100. Does this seem right to anyone who has had this done or knowledge of parts/service prices. It is out of warranty, and although it was replaced once under the original warranty, I am being told that replacement was only covered through the remainder of the original warranty period.

Re: A/C compressor replacement cost?
I believe part warranty is 12/12 or until end of original warranty, whichever is longer.
That price sounds awful high.
GM pays on warranty, 1.0 hour to replace the compressor with an add time of 0.5 to recovery/charge the A/C system (Labor operation D4440). Don't have the part cost here at home, but I'm going to guess around $300-$400 at max. Compressor is easy to change, and one hour is sufficient.
$400 for compressor + $120 for labor + $70.00 for refrigerant.
